Transaction 8abcec27f2897225837e77e163b4a55804e0d76fa10a1e0925978f7ea55d7ee4
1 Input
1 Output
-
8abcec27f2897225837e77e163b4a55804e0d76fa10a1e0925978f7ea55d7ee4:0
- value
- 131402
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d45128f85c20495fb95233653774d36e26cca343 OP_EQUAL
- address
- 3M3eQJwq8iwfugdb3gTzfShnfzhJ9mMoM3